Memorial to the Six Million at Greenwood Cemetery

The Memorial to the Six Million is located in the south section of Greenwood Cemetery. Completed in 1965, it was the second Holocaust memorial to be built in the United States. The memorial was designed by architect and child survivor of the Holocaust, Benjamin Hirsch, and funded by members of Eternal Life-Hemshech. For directions to the memorial, view the map above.
